32

1 ALIF LAM MIM.
2 The revelation of this Book free of doubt and involution is from the Lord of all the worlds.
3 Or do they say he has fabricated it? In fact, it is the truth from your Lord so that you may warn the people to whom no admonisher was sent before you. They may haply come to guidance.
4 It is God who created the heavens and the earth and all that lies between them, in six spans, then assumed all authority. You have no protector other than Him, nor any intercessor. Will you not be warned even then?
5 He regulates all affairs from high to low, then they rise to perfection step by step in a (heavenly) day whose measure is a thousand years of your reckoning.
6 Such is (He) the knower of the unknown and the known, the mighty and the merciful,
7 Who made all things He created excellent; and first fashioned man from clay,
8 Then made his offspring from the extract of base fluid,
9 Then proportioned and breathed into him of His spirit, and gave you the senses of hearing, sight and feeling. And yet how little are the thanks you offer!
10 But they say: "When we have mingled with the earth, shall we be created anew?" In fact they deny the meeting with their Lord.
11 Say: "The angel of death appointed over you will take away your soul, then you will be sent back to your Lord."
12 If only you could see when the sinners will stand before their Lord, heads hung low, (and say:) "O Lord, we have seen and heard. So send us back. We shall do the right, for we have come to believe with certainty."
13 Had We intended We could have given every soul its guidance; but inevitable is My word that I will fill up Hell with men and jinns together.
14 So now suffer. As you forgot the meeting of this your Day of Doom, so have We forgotten you. Now taste the everlasting punishment for your deeds.
15 Only they believe in Our revelations who, when they are reminded, bow in adoration, and give praise to their Lord, and do not become arrogant.
16 Their backs do not rest on their beds, and they pray to their Lord in fear and hope, and spend of what We have given them (in charity).
17 No soul knows what peace and joy lie hidden from them as reward for what they have done.
18 Is one who is a believer like one who is a transgressor? No, they are not alike.
19 As for those who believe and do the right, there are gardens for abode as welcome for what they had done.
20 As for those who disobey, their abode is Hell. Whensoever they wish to escape from it they would be dragged back into it, and told: "Taste the torment of the Fire which you used to call a lie."
21 But We shall make them taste the affliction of this world before the greater torment, so that they may retract.
22 Who is more wicked than he who is reminded of his Lord´s revelations yet turns away from them; We will surely requite the sinners.
23 Verily We gave Moses the Book; so be not in doubt about his having received it; and We made it a guidance for the children of Israel.
24 When they persevered and firmly believed Our revelations We appointed learned men among them who guided them by Our command.
25 Surely your Lord will decide between them about what they were at variance, on the Day of Resurrection.
26 Did they not find guidance in the many generations We had destroyed before them, over whose dwellings they (now) walk? There were indeed signs in this. Will they even then not listen?
27 Do they not see that We drive the rain towards a land that is dry, then grow grain from it which their cattle and they themselves eat? Will they not see even then?
28 Yet they say: "When will this decree come, if you speak the truth?"
29 Say: "Of no use will be the acceptance of belief to unbelievers on the Day of Decision, nor will they be granted respite.
30 Therefore turn away from them and wait as they are waiting.
